Nonlinear analysis of stationary patterns in convection-reaction-diffusion systems

摘要

Stationary spatially inhomogeneous patterns which appear due to the interaction of reaction and convection in a packed-bed cross-flow reactor are observed and analyzed. A linear stability analysis was performed for the case of unbounded system, and an analytical expression for the amplification threshold was determined. Above this threshold stationary patterns could be sustained in bounded systems. A weakly nonlinear analysis is used in order to derive the governing amplitude equation. The results of linear and nonlinear analyses were verified by direct numerical simulations. [References: 20]
